The Kulomet 15 mm HMG ZB-60 is a Czechoslovakian 15 mm gas operated, tripod-mounted heavy machine-gun intended for infantry fire support but also employed in an anti-aircraft role. The ZB-60 takes a 40-round beltfeed and fires with a muzzle velocity of 905 meters per second to a range of 2400 meters with a cyclic rate of 430 rounds per minute. The ZB-60 has a 1090 mm long barrel and is fitted with a blade foresight and an aperture rear sight. Research ZB-60
